Transaction 73c6ef6271d6c5919a1ba2aaee9b0bc4caf3f9ef73e7a94f56721722e2baad38

2 Input
2 Outputs
  • 73c6ef6271d6c5919a1ba2aaee9b0bc4caf3f9ef73e7a94f56721722e2baad38:0
  • value  4341275483
    address  36hwbVShSjKEhiHPScjX4DKf3ushLUi4Fv
  • 73c6ef6271d6c5919a1ba2aaee9b0bc4caf3f9ef73e7a94f56721722e2baad38:1
  • value  16000000000
    address  3AVyvscY9Y9h9S8Nb7EM6roi9MyrRrsYkW